Output 8b61c3d37ae06869b666c318a99b16a27df9165cfad1b49dfd26bb0afb1c3a37:6

value
544084309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3c17fefeebb9203f4fdeb9294f0d25575b8eaf OP_EQUAL
address
3MgDtwW6b98na1HbRj1fKPHHWND2SP2e1L
transaction
8b61c3d37ae06869b666c318a99b16a27df9165cfad1b49dfd26bb0afb1c3a37
spent
true